HWM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2026 in Review

1,596 of the 8,279 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Howmet Aerospace (HWM) for Q2 2026, worth a combined $97.6B — up 17% from $83.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 230 funds opened new HWM positions and 84 closed out — a net gain of 146 holders — while 671 added to existing stakes and 489 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Citadel Advisors, adding an estimated $463M. The largest seller was Massachusetts Financial Services, cutting an estimated $681M.
